- 30
- 0
- 约9.77千字
- 约 16页
- 2016-12-11 发布于河南
- 举报
实验5—面向对象的高级程序设计
实验日期和时间:
实验室:
班级:
学号:
姓名:
实验环境:
硬件:
主频:2.20 GHz
内存:海力士 DDR3 1600 MHz 2GB
硬盘空间:500GB 5400转/分
操作系统版本:win7
软件:Microsoft Visual Studio 2010
实验主要任务:
设计一个Windows应用程序,在该程序中首先构造一个学生基本类,再分别构造小学生、中学生、大学生等派生类,当输入相关数据,单击不同的按钮(小学生、中学生、大学生)将分别创建不同的学生对象,并输入当前的学生人数、该学生的姓名、学生类型和平均成绩。要求如下:
①每个学生都有姓名和年龄。
②小学生有语文、数学成绩。
③中学生有语文、数学和英语成绩。
④大学生有必修课学分总数和选修课学分总数,不包含单科成绩。
⑤学生类提供向外输出信息的方法。
⑥学生类提供统计个人总成绩或总学分的方法。
⑦通过静态成员自动记录学生的总人数。
⑧能通过构造函数完成各字段成员初始化。
设计一个Windows应用程序,在该程序中定义平面图形抽象类和其派生类圆、矩形和三角形。该程序实现的功能包括:输入相应的图形的参数,如矩形的长和宽,单击相应的按钮,根据输入参数创建图形类并输出该图形的面积。
声明一个播放器接口IPlayer,包含5个接口方法:播放、停止、暂停、上一首和下一首。设计
原创力文档

文档评论(0)